Output 2f4defca10596e10bdcf642ad68060803071bc2cd86a037cdcd3edcb52059ea8:7

value
20492203
script pubkey
OP_0 OP_PUSHBYTES_32 25aaca3c1ccf67864c8d87638a3c219da3acc73735deaa57681bef069a206da7
address
bc1qyk4v50queancvnydsa3c50ppnk36e3ehxh0254mgr0hsdx3qdknsm4tkm8
transaction
2f4defca10596e10bdcf642ad68060803071bc2cd86a037cdcd3edcb52059ea8
spent
true